Hi
Does any one know of a DTMF Amplifier. I need to amplify the incoming DTMF audio tones on a phone line without amplifying the voice audio. <p>Abu

The tone you hear and the sound you hear are the same path ways. <p>They both come in on the same amplifier and wires. <p>You can detect the tone with a DTMF receiver, and have it "logically" switch what ever you want. <p>If you need it separated from the sound, and still amplified, I would use a repeater DTMF configuration where the signal is decoded by one DTMF reciever, and then recreated on another DTMF transmitter, and on to that separate circuit to isolate the two sounds for what ever use you have in mind.
